Bhubaneswar: Officials of the Vigilance Department today caught a sub-inspector of Dhauli Police Station in Bhubaneswar, Pradeep Mahala while he was taking bribe from a person in connection with a case.

As per reports, Mahala had demanded Rs 30,000 from one Jyoti Ranjan Pani to settle a land-dispute case at the Dhauli Police Station. However, he was caught red-handed by the sleuths today. The Vigilance team is also interrogating Mahala based on allegations against him amassing assets disproportionate to his known sources of income.

According to sources, Pradeep had joined the police services as a Sub-Inspector in the year 2013. However, allegations of corruption were raised against him time and again, department sources said.
The Vigilance officials have also initiated an investigation to find out if there is any involvement of other officials of the police station in such incidents of bribery.

S Radhakrishnan, SP, Vigilance Cell, said "The Vigilance officials caught the SI while he was taking a bribe of Rs 30,000 from Jyoti Ranjan Pani to settle a land dispute case. Primary investigations revealed that the SI had taken the bribe. Further investigation is on."

Earlier on September 2018, Vigilance sleuths had arrested the Inspector-in-Charge (IIC) of Jatni Police Station after he was caught red-handed receiving bribe of Rs 50,000.
